Rigid stainless steel osteosynthesis plates (DCP/ASIF) were attached bilaterally onto the intact tibio-fibular bone in 40 rabbits. Axial compression was used on the right side, neutral plate fixation on the left. The radiographic appearances of the bone were analysed 1 day, and 1, 3, 12, 24 and 36 weeks postoperatively. The changes in the bone were progressive, related to the time of fixation, and similar in the right and left leg. The main alterations were a progressive thinning of the cortical bone under the plate and a progressive cancellous transformation of the tubular bone.
